Senior Electronics Engineer in Leatherhead, Surrey
Location
Leatherhead, SurreySalary
Up to £55000.00 per annumContract
PermanentWe are recruiting for a Senior Electronics Engineer to work for our client in the Leatherhead area. This is an excellent opportunity to work for a progressive business who have a strong reputation in their industry. You will oversee a small electronics team developing new and existing systems which are used for the medical industry.
The ideal candidate will have:
- Experience of taking designs from concept to production.
- A degree in Electronics Engineering
- Experience of digital and analogue hardware design.
- Experience of designing for EMC, Environmental Regulations and Safety Standards
- Excellent CAD skills
The position comes with an excellent benefits package including company shares schemes, flexible working hours, hybrid working, free on-site parking and life insurance.
